    inchinch1 /ɪntʃ/ noun [countable] 查看全部语言翻译1 (written abbreviation in British English or in. American English) a unit for measuring length, equal to 2.54 centimetres. There are 12 inches in a foot英寸,长度单位,等于2.54厘米。1英尺等于12英寸。:  The curtains were an inch too short.窗帘短了一英寸。 Rainfall here is under 15 inches a year.这里年降雨量不足15英寸。a one-/two-/three- etc inch something a six-inch nail六英寸长的钉子2a very small distance极短的距离:  Derek leaned closer, his face only inches from hers.德里克俯身靠近,他的脸离她的脸只有几英寸。 The bus missed us by inches.那辆公共汽车差几英寸就撞上我们了。 On several occasions, they came within inches of death.他们曾数次与死亡相差不过几英寸。3every inch a)completely or in every way完全地;在各方面:  With her designer clothes and elegant hair, she looks every inch the celebrity.她身着名牌服装,发型优雅,完全是一副名流的派头。 b)the whole of an area or distance整个区域或距离inch of Every inch of space in the tiny shop was crammed with goods.这家小店的每一寸空间都塞满了货物。 Italy deserved to win, though Greece made them fight every inch of the way.意大利理应获胜,但希腊让他们一寸一寸地拼到了底。4give somebody an inch and they’ll take a yard/mile used to say that, if you allow someone a little freedom or power, they will try to take more用于表示若给某人一点自由或权力,他们便会得寸进尺5inch by inch moving very gradually and slowly极缓慢地、一点一点地移动:  Inch by inch, he lowered himself from the roof.他一寸一寸地从屋顶降了下来。6not give/budge an inch to refuse to change your decision or opinion, even though people are trying to persuade you to do this拒绝改变决定或意见,即使他人极力劝说:  Neither side is prepared to give an inch in the negotiations.谈判中双方均不愿让步半分。7beat/thrash etc somebody to within an inch of their life to beat someone very hard and thoroughly将某人痛打一顿:  Another word out of you and I’ll beat you to within an inch of your life.你要再多说一个字,我就把你打到半死。
    inchinch2 verb [intransitive, transitive always + adverb/preposition] to move very slowly in a particular direction, or to make something do this朝某一方向极缓慢地移动,或使某物如此移动:  I inched forward along the ground.我沿着地面慢慢向前挪动。
